Transaction 42f3844cae376812fa126d509f627a31231da4d88154a84786f582cc79267d5a
1 Input
1 Output
-
42f3844cae376812fa126d509f627a31231da4d88154a84786f582cc79267d5a:0
- value
- 105270000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3845722b1bf119bab6658cca283cc13aaee1059b OP_EQUALVERIFY OP_CHECKSIG
- address
- 168Y2w7z7ALko33iP982oKE3bmPfv9KhtE